Understanding DirectX in DayZ: What You Need to Know

DayZ, the survival horror game set in a post-apocalyptic world, has captivated millions of players since its original release as a mod for ARMA 2. Since transitioning to a standalone title, it has continued to evolve, drawing players into its immersive environments filled with tension and the constant threat of danger. Central to delivering this experience is a technological backbone that enhances graphics, audio, and overall performance. One of the most critical components of this backbone is DirectX. This article dives deep into what DirectX is, the specific version that DayZ utilizes, and how it impacts gameplay and graphics.

What Is DirectX?

DirectX is a set of application programming interfaces (APIs) developed by Microsoft that allows software developers to create applications that can handle multimedia tasks like gaming, video playback, and 3D graphics rendering. This powerful toolkit provides the ability to use hardware features more efficiently, enabling smoother graphics and optimal performance.

The key functions of DirectX can be summarized as follows:

  • Graphics Rendering: DirectX streamlines the rendering of 2D and 3D images, allowing for stunning visuals in games.
  • Audio Management: It facilitates sound rendering, enabling immersive audio experiences in complex environments.
  • Input Management: It’s responsible for processing input from various devices, such as keyboards and controllers.

The continuous evolution of DirectX means that it has been pivotal in pushing the boundaries of what is possible in video games.

The Importance Of DirectX In Gaming

DirectX is not just another tool in the developer’s toolbox; it plays a vital role in gaming by enabling:

Performance Optimization

DirectX enhances the efficiency of hardware utilization, enabling developers to optimize their games to run smoothly on a broad range of devices. This is particularly crucial in a multiplayer setting like DayZ, where performance can make or break the experience.

Enhanced Visuals

With each new version of DirectX, developers gain access to advanced graphical features. This includes support for cutting-edge technologies like ray tracing and advanced shaders, which can significantly enhance the visual fidelity of a game.

Cross-Platform Compatibility

DirectX simplifies the process of developing for multiple hardware setups. This is essential for a game like DayZ, which needs to perform well across various systems without compromising the experience for any user.

Which Version Of DirectX Does DayZ Use?

As of the latest updates, DayZ primarily uses DirectX 11. Introduced in 2009, DirectX 11 has become a standard for many gaming titles. It offers several significant improvements over its predecessors, making it an ideal choice for modern game development.

Why DirectX 11 Is Ideal For DayZ

There are multiple reasons why DirectX 11 is suitable for DayZ:

  • Improved Graphics Capabilities: DirectX 11 facilitates more complex shaders and texture mapping techniques, allowing for richer environments and more realistic character models, which is crucial for the game’s immersive nature.
  • Multi-threading Support: DayZ benefits from DirectX 11’s multi-threading capabilities, enabling better resource management and allowing the game to utilize multiple CPU cores efficiently.

How DirectX 11 Impacts DayZ’s Gameplay Experience

DirectX 11 is not solely about graphics; its influence seeps into various aspects of gameplay, affecting how players interact with the world.

Graphics And Visual Fidelity

One of the most noticeable impacts of DirectX 11 on DayZ is in its graphical fidelity.

Dynamic Lighting and Shadows

Dynamic lighting creates a realistic atmosphere, where players must navigate the environment carefully as the day/night cycle affects visibility. Shadows are rendered more dynamically, providing depth to the world and enhancing overall immersion.

Texture Quality

DirectX 11 allows DayZ to utilize higher resolution textures without sacrificing performance. This results in more detailed environments—from the grass and trees to the crumbling buildings—making the world feel alive and reactive.

Post-Processing Effects

Post-processing techniques like anti-aliasing and motion blur improve the overall visual quality of DayZ, allowing for breathtaking scenery that elevates the gameplay experience.

Performance And Stability

In terms of performance, DirectX 11 has shown remarkable capabilities.

Frame Rates and Responsiveness

With DirectX 11’s ability to efficiently utilize system resources, players are likely to experience more stable frame rates. This is critical in a competitive survival game like DayZ, where split-second decisions can determine life or death.

Load Times

DirectX 11 optimizes load times by streamlining the way data is processed, which benefits players who wish to dive back into action quickly.

Future Prospects: DirectX 12

While DayZ currently harnesses the power of DirectX 11, DirectX 12 has been released with even more advanced features that could potentially benefit future updates or sequels to the game.

The Advantages Of DirectX 12

DirectX 12 offers several enhancements that could benefit DayZ:

  • Lower-Level Hardware Access: This allows developers to fine-tune performance and graphics rendering even more precisely, leading to further improvements in visual fidelity and efficiency.
  • Improved Multi-threading: Building on its predecessor’s capabilities, DirectX 12 can better distribute workloads across CPU cores, providing enhanced performance even in CPU-bound scenarios.

Potential For Future Updates

Considering the popularity of DayZ and the rapid evolution of gaming technology, it’s plausible that future updates might integrate DirectX 12 features. This could lead to enhanced graphics and even more immersive gameplay.

Conclusion

DirectX is an indispensable component of DayZ, serving as the technology that empowers developers to create a rich, immersive, and engaging experience for players. By utilizing DirectX 11, DayZ achieves impressive graphics, stable performance, and an engaging atmosphere that contributes significantly to its status as a leading survival game.

While there have been discussions of transitioning to newer technologies like DirectX 12, the current implementation has proven effective in delivering thrilling gameplay. Players can expect further enhancements in graphics and performance as technology continues to advance, ensuring that the world of DayZ remains captivating for years to come.

In summary, understanding the role of DirectX in DayZ not only highlights the technological achievements of the game but also emphasizes the ongoing evolution of gaming experiences in a rapidly changing digital landscape. Ensuring your system meets the necessary requirements for DirectX 11 can remarkably enhance your DayZ experience, making every encounter in its treacherous world even more exhilarating.

What Is DirectX And Why Is It Important For DayZ?

DirectX is a collection of application programming interfaces (APIs) created by Microsoft, designed to facilitate high-performance multimedia and gaming experiences on Windows. It provides developers with the necessary tools to access hardware features of graphics cards, sound cards, and input devices. For DayZ, an open-world survival game, DirectX plays a crucial role in rendering the game’s graphics and ensuring smooth gameplay, especially in a visually demanding environment.

Using DirectX allows DayZ to take advantage of advanced graphics techniques, such as real-time lighting, shadowing, and texture rendering. This enhancement substantially improves the visual fidelity of the game, making environments more immersive and lifelike. With DirectX properly utilized, players can expect smoother frame rates, better responsiveness, and a more engaging gaming experience overall.

What Version Of DirectX Does DayZ Use?

DayZ primarily uses DirectX 11, which was a significant upgrade from previous versions, introducing numerous enhancements in graphics quality and performance. DirectX 11 enables developers to create more detailed and complex graphics, making it well-suited for the expansive and dynamic environments featured in DayZ. This version supports features such as tessellation, multi-threading, and improved texture handling, all of which contribute to the game’s visual appeal.

While DirectX 12 has been released and offers even more advanced capabilities, DayZ remains on DirectX 11. The decision to stick with this version allows the game to maintain a balance between performance and compatibility, ensuring that a broader range of players can enjoy the game without requiring the latest hardware. As development continues, there may be future updates or expansions that could consider transitioning to newer versions of DirectX.

How Can I Improve My DayZ Performance By Optimizing DirectX Settings?

To improve DayZ performance, it’s essential to tweak both in-game settings and your system’s DirectX configurations. Start by accessing the graphics settings within DayZ and reducing options such as texture quality, shadow quality, and view distance. Lowering these settings can significantly increase frame rates and decrease lag, particularly in densely populated areas or during intense encounters with other players or zombies.

Additionally, ensure that your graphics drivers are up to date, as manufacturers like NVIDIA and AMD regularly release optimizations for popular games. You can also adjust your system’s power management settings to prioritize performance over energy saving. If needed, consider modifying settings in the DirectX control panel or using tools that help manage system resources while playing. These steps can create a smoother gameplay experience while making full use of what DirectX offers.

Are There Known Issues While Using DirectX With DayZ?

While DirectX provides many benefits for optimizing graphics and performance in DayZ, some players experience issues related to compatibility and stability. Common problems include graphical glitches such as flickering textures, low frame rates, and crashes, particularly when running systems that may not fully support DirectX 11 capabilities. Additionally, certain hardware configurations may pose challenges, leading to inconsistent performance.

To mitigate these issues, players should ensure that their graphics drivers are current and that their hardware meets the game’s recommended specifications. Participating in community forums or the DayZ support channels may provide insights into specific problems and their fixes, allowing players to troubleshoot and optimize their experience. Regular game updates frequently address known bugs, enhancing overall stability and performance.

Is DirectX 12 Support Planned For DayZ In The Future?

As of now, there hasn’t been any official announcement regarding DirectX 12 support for DayZ. The game’s development team has focused on refining and expanding the existing features of the game while maintaining compatibility with DirectX 11. Transitioning to a newer version of DirectX entails significant changes and challenges, particularly when it comes to ensuring that the game remains accessible to a wide player base.

However, the gaming industry continually evolves, with new technologies and updates being regularly evaluated. It’s possible that future updates to DayZ could explore the potential for implementing DirectX 12, especially if it enhances performance and graphical capabilities. Keeping an eye on developer blogs and community channels is beneficial for players interested in any developments related to DirectX support in the game.

How Do I Check If My DirectX Installation Is Functioning Correctly For DayZ?

To check if your DirectX installation is functioning correctly on your system for playing DayZ, you can use the DirectX Diagnostic Tool (dxdiag). Start by pressing the Windows key and typing “dxdiag” into the search bar, then hit enter. This tool will provide detailed information about your DirectX version, installed drivers, and any issues that have been detected with your graphics or sound cards.

In addition to checking the version, it’s wise to run a test by launching DayZ. Observe the game’s performance and whether any graphical issues arise while playing. If you encounter significant problems or errors, it may indicate that your DirectX installation could need fixing or that your drivers require updates. Regularly running these checks helps ensure a smoother gaming experience while playing DayZ.

Leave a Comment